Rationally Constructed
Developed or created based on logical reasoning and thoughtful consideration.
Item Response Theory (IRT)
A theory and method used in education and psychology to model the relationship between individuals' skills or traits and their performance on test items.
Empirical Method
A scientific approach that relies on observation and experiment rather than theory or pure logic.
Fundamental Personality Traits
Core traits believed to constitute the foundation of human personality, often related to the Big Five personality dimensions.
